Two new board members for TUI Travel

Thursday, 18 Dec, 2013 0

Two new board members of TUI Travel are due to be elected in February after two serving directors stepped down.

Tony Campbell, who joined the board from First Choice when the tour operators merged in 2007, is standing down, as is Voker Bottcher, managing director of the Group’s German Specialist Division.

In their place, two new directors will be proposed for election to the Board as non-executive directors at the Annual General Meeting in February.

One is Val Gooding, also non-executive chairman of Premier Farnell, and  who has been appointed a non-executive director of Vodaphone from February 2014.

She spent many years at British Airways as head of cabin services, head of marketing, director Asia Pacific and director of business units – responsible for BA retail shops, charter airline and tour operator businesses.

The other is Vladimir Yakushev, managing partner of private equity company S-Group Capital Management. Based in Moscow, S-Group is TUI Travel’s joint venture partner in Russia.
